Professional Work 01 -Guoliang Art SRTP Center
Firm: Smart Construction of Villages, Wuhan University
Project Manager: Chujin Xue, Xiaoqin Hu
Design Team: Yan Xiong, Sheng Luo, Yanyi Chen, Wenshan Luo, Lingfeng Pa , Zhouqi Fu, Yixin Li, Gongwen Lu
Date: 2022
Location: Guo Liang Village, Sha Yao Township, Hui Xian City, Henan Province, China
Located in the cliffside village of Guoliang—famous for its hand-carved mountain road—this project transforms a former elementary school into an art and education retreat. The design pays tribute to the “Sky Road” by extending its spirit through a dramatic circulation path linking classrooms to a rooftop viewing platform. Original stone walls and slanted brick façades are preserved with a new steel frame, while prefabricated wood modules add minimal lodging and service functions. A sunken courtyard and glazed pavilion support outdoor teaching, reactivating a site of collective memory through light-touch construction.
